Senior Automation Tester
Adree is seeking a highly motivated Senior Automation Tester to join our vibrant Quality Assurance team. The successful candidate will play a crucial role in enhancing our testing processes through automation, thereby ensuring the robustness and reliability of our software products. This position demands a strong technical acumen, keen attention to detail, and the ability to collaborate with developers, product managers, and other stakeholders.
Key Responsibilities:
- Design, develop, and execute automated test scripts utilizing tools such as Selenium, Appium, or similar.
- Collaborate with cross-functional teams to review requirements and specifications, ensuring clear understanding prior to test planning.
- Implement test automation best practices and continuously improve the automation framework.
- Perform regression testing and maintain existing automated tests post-deployment.
- Analyze test results, track defects, and document the testing phase to facilitate thorough reviews.
- Lead and mentor junior team members in best practices for automation testing.
- Participate in Agile ceremonies and contribute to the overall improvement of testing and development processes.
Requirements
- 4+ years of professional experience in automation testing.
- Proficient in programming languages such as Java, C#, or Python.
- Strong experience with automation testing frameworks and tools, especially Selenium and Appium.
- Solid understanding of various testing methodologies, including functional, regression, and performance testing.
- Experience with CI/CD tools and practices.
- Excellent analytical skills and the ability to troubleshoot complex software issues.
- Strong communication skills, both written and verbal, with the ability to articulate testing issues clearly.
- Experience working in an Agile development environment.
- Bachelor's degree in Computer Science, Engineering, or a related field is preferred.
- Experience in using test management tools (e.g., JIRA, TestRail) is an advantage.